Skicarosello, a leading lift company in Alta Badia, has recently renewed its UNI EN ISO 45001 certification for occupational health and safety management and UNI EN ISO 14001 certification for environmental management, reaffirming its ongoing commitment to the highest standards of safety, sustainability and social responsibility.

UNI EN ISO 45001: Workplace safety comes first

The UNI EN ISO 45001 certification is an international standard that sets requirements for occupational health and safety management systems.
By renewing this certification, Skicarosello confirms its priority: creating a safe and healthy working environment for employees, collaborators and partners. The company implements preventive measures and best practices to minimize workplace risks and ensure conditions that protect both the physical and mental well-being of its team.
This certification reflects Skicarosello’s strong safety culture, one that involves every team member and shapes daily operations, from lift maintenance to guest services. Continuous risk assessment and the search for innovative prevention solutions are at the core of a management system that touches every operational area.

UNI EN ISO 14001: Protecting the environment and the mountain landscape

The renewal of the UNI EN ISO 14001 certification highlights Skicarosello’s concrete commitment to sustainability and environmental stewardship.
This international standard defines the criteria for an environmental management system that enables companies to monitor, control and reduce the environmental impact of their activities.
Skicarosello has long prioritized the responsible management of natural resources, aiming to minimize the ecological footprint of its operations. From waste management to energy efficiency initiatives, every activity is designed with respect for the alpine environment that welcomes visitors year-round.
Renewing ISO 14001 further strengthens the company’s commitment to ensuring that every project, whether installing new lifts or maintaining existing infrastructure, is carried out responsibly, reducing environmental impact and promoting sustainable land management.

Renewable Energy Community (CER)

At the beginning of 2025, the Skicarosello Corvara Consortium, operator and owner of the Movimënt parks, established a Renewable Energy Community (REC).
This initiative allows Skicarosello to use surplus energy generated from its own renewable sources directly to power its lift systems.
A Renewable Energy Community (REC) is an association formed to locally produce, share, and consume electricity from renewable sources in a sustainable way.

The goal

  • Generate clean energy independently
  • Reduce operational costs
  • Support the ecological transition
  • Strengthen collaboration among participating companies


How does it work?

Within a REC, photovoltaic systems or other renewable sources (such as wind or hydropower) are installed. The energy produced is shared among members and any surplus can be fed back into the grid.
Each participating company benefits from locally generated, shared energy.

The benefits

  • Energy and cost savings
  • Greater efficiency and stability thanks to local production and consumption
  • Reduced CO₂ emissions
  • Added value for the local territory
  • Active participation in the energy transition
